I stopped my clock from chiming because we had house guests that it disturbed at night. Now that I wish to restart the chimes, I can't find my booklet and do not know how to get it to chime the hour number. Right now, it will only chime once on each hour and once each half hour. I suspect what has happened is that the strike shut off lever has gotten something out of position, prohibiting the strike rack from falling into its proper position. (The strike rack controls the number of blows the hammers make to the gong.) If you wish to try this, I will need your e-mail address so that I can transmit drawings, if needed.
